About Markus Taumberger
Markus Taumberger is a scholar working on Water Science and Technology, Computer Networks and Communications, Electrical and Electronic Engineering, Plant Science and Control and Systems Engineering, having authored 7 papers that have together received 394 indexed citations. Recurring topics across this work include Water Quality Monitoring Technologies (2 papers), Smart Agriculture and AI (2 papers), IoT Networks and Protocols (1 paper), Energy Efficient Wireless Sensor Networks (1 paper), Augmented Reality Applications (1 paper), Smart Grid Security and Resilience (1 paper), Water-Energy-Food Nexus Studies (1 paper) and Power Line Communications and Noise (1 paper). The work is most often cited by research in Water Science and Technology (134 citations), Plant Science (201 citations), Soil Science (47 citations), Computer Networks and Communications (111 citations) and Environmental Engineering (30 citations). Markus Taumberger has collaborated with scholars based in Finland, Italy and Brazil. Frequent co-authors include Rodrigo Filev Maia, Juha-Pekka Soininen, Tullio Salmon Cinotti, Carlos Kamienski, André Torre Neto, Attilio Toscano, Ramide Dantas, Stênio Fernandes, Jussi Kiljander and Janne Takalo-Mattila. Their work appears in journals such as Sensors, IEEE Access, SHILAP Revista de lepidopterología, University of Thessaly Institutional Repository (University of Thessaly) and Archivio istituzionale della ricerca (Alma Mater Studiorum Università di Bologna).
